    I don't recommend this University

    College Infrastructure

    Infrastructure is not so excellent. Living spaces are clean but food is not Good . Libraries are well maintained . WiFi are so Good .so overall infrastructure is not so good . I don't recommend this University.

    Academics

    Academic is not Good. Finance ,accounts,operations management and other more departments are not good enough .faculties are also not good . Some faculties are good but not all in terms of behavior. ..

    Placements

    Placements are normal. Average package of the companies is 3-4 laks and does not provide any other allowances . Internships are also not provided by the jecrc University. Internship department is also worst.

    Value for Money

    Value for money Fees is moderate.

    Campus Life

    Campus life is so good

    Others

    I am not prfer this University.

To be honest both JNU and JECRC Jaipur are good colleges but it's a tough call to choose one because they almost offer same courses and are even located in the same area. Every university has its own advantages and disadvantages but you as a students can choose one by reckoning which course you want or whether the university is affordable or not.

    Both are self financed private universities and NAAC accredited with B grade. In JNU the fees per sem for Bcom is 7,000 and in case of JECRC it is 13,050 per annum.  JECRC provides scholarship programs on a merit basis and also campus placements in MNCs. While JNU provides printed notes and online lectures.

    JNU Jaipur conducts several seminars and workshops to train students in various aspects of getting a job and also organizes group discussions, extempore to overcome the fear of hesitation while facing an interview.

    JECRC University is famous for providing placements to students and the university has invited firms like Accenture, Capgemini, TCS, and more. The university has made records in providing campus placements to students.
